The DASSNANE slate coasters arrived in my shop double-boxed with foam between each layer. I ran my first batch of 12 through the CO2 laser at 30W with 300 mm/s speed, and the contrast was excellent. The dark slate turned a soft, even gray that made white-paint infill pop.
For volume sellers, this is the slate blank I keep coming back to. Each piece has unique natural veining, which actually adds character to custom wedding favors and housewarming gifts. After running 240 coasters through my workflow, breakage sat at just 4 pieces, an acceptable rate for natural stone.

The anti-slip rubber pads on the bottom are a small touch that customers notice. It makes the finished coaster feel premium rather than DIY. Sizes come in both round and square, and the 0.3 cm thickness accepts deep engraving without cracking.
I did notice some thickness variation of about 0.5 mm between pieces. Setting up the Z-axis height required manual adjustment every 5 to 6 coasters, which slowed production slightly. The matte slate also tends to show oily fingerprints until the customer handles it for the first time.
Sharp corners caught me twice during unboxing. I now use cut-resistant gloves when sorting bulk orders. If you sand the corners lightly with a 220-grit block, you eliminate this issue in about 30 seconds per piece.

Best use cases and compatibility
This slate works beautifully with CO2 lasers at 30W or higher. Diode laser users get decent results but should lower speed to 1500 mm/s for cleaner etching. Fiber lasers struggle with natural slate due to inconsistent mineral content.
Skip this blank if you need precision photographic engraving. Slate’s grain structure creates natural noise in fine detail. It excels at bold fonts, monograms, and line art designs.
Who should skip these blanks
If you are selling at ultra-low price points under five dollars per coaster, the per-piece cost gets tight. Also avoid if you run a fully automated workflow without manual Z-axis adjustment.

Wood keychains remain one of my highest-margin laser products, and the WRINGKIT beech blanks earned a permanent spot on my shelf. The 2 by 1.2 inch size fits perfectly in a wallet pocket and accepts both names and small logos. After engraving 300 of these for a local pet-tag business, I can confirm the quality is consistent from piece to piece.
The 0.3 inch thickness provides real durability. Customers do not worry about bending or breaking these in their pockets. I tested them against a 10W diode laser at 100 percent power and 200 mm/s, and the burn came out deep, dark, and even.

Beech wood engraves cleaner than many softwoods. The tight grain structure means less charring and crisper letter edges. I also ran them through my wood-burning pen for comparison, and the laser results were noticeably sharper.
The included split rings are the one weak spot. They spin freely but cannot be removed without pliers. This made it tricky to align designs perfectly during setup. I solved this by taping the ring to the side of the blank before clamping.
Color-wise, the natural beech tone is light. For designs where you want maximum contrast, a quick coat of dark wood stain before engraving or paint infill after works wonders. Untreated, expect a medium-brown burn that reads well on lighter wood.

Best use cases and compatibility
These blanks shine as pet tags, name tags for bags, and small gift keychains. Both 10W diode and 40W CO2 lasers handle them easily. Fiber lasers can mark the surface but will not cut through the wood at standard settings.
Engrave at 1000 dpi for crisp text. Anything below 500 dpi looks pixelated on this smooth surface. Use air assist to keep char residue off your lens.
Who should skip these blanks
If you need blank keychains where the ring is fully removable, look elsewhere. Also, if your customers expect dark walnut tones, beech will look too light for their taste.

AceSubli’s license plate blanks fill a niche I had been ignoring for years. Real estate signs, novelty front plates, and small business advertising all benefit from a 6×12 inch aluminum surface. I tested these on my K40 CO2 laser, which only puts out about 40W, and the results were surprisingly crisp.
The glossy black coating is smooth out of the box, and the protective film keeps fingerprints off during shipping. I peeled the film right before loading each plate into my laser bed, and the engraved areas came out clean white against the black background.

At 0.6mm thickness, these plates are flexible but durable. They survived drops onto concrete without denting. For outdoor use, the aluminum core resists rust while the coating holds up well under UV exposure.
The main drawback is the delicate black surface. Once the protective film is off, the coating scuffs if you drag another plate across it. I now store finished plates in a dedicated foam-lined tray to avoid this.
Also note that the glossy black makes these unsuitable for sublimation printing. They are laser-and-vinyl only. If your customers expect dye-sublimation results, route them toward white sublimation blanks instead.

Best use cases and compatibility
Use these for real estate signs, garage decor, business advertising, and novelty gifts. Fiber lasers produce the cleanest results because they vaporize the coating rather than melting it. CO2 lasers work fine with proper power settings around 25 percent at 300 mm/s.
Diode lasers struggle with bare aluminum because the wavelength reflects off the metal. The black coating helps diode lasers mark the surface, but expect slower speeds and lighter contrast.
Who should skip these blanks
If you want a true outdoor-grade sign rated for years of weather, consider powder-coated aluminum instead. These will last a season or two outdoors but are best for covered patios or indoor display.

The Danghyuk metal business card blanks are my go-to for networking events. Three hundred pieces in a single pack brings the cost down to roughly 8 cents per card. I lasered 150 of these for a tech startup, and every single card came out with clean detail and high contrast.
The black coating vaporizes cleanly under a 40W CO2 laser, revealing the silver aluminum underneath. White-paint infill makes text pop dramatically. The 3.4 by 2.2 inch dimensions match standard credit cards, so they fit in any wallet.

For diode laser users, air assist is essential. Without it, the heat builds up and warps the 0.2mm aluminum. I lost about 5 percent of my test batch to warping before adding air assist, then dropped that to nearly zero.
The thickness surprised me. At 0.2mm, these feel more like thick paper than metal. They bend easily if you press on the center. For business cards, this is fine because no one flexes a card deliberately. For tags or signage, step up to thicker stock.
I also noticed the engraved silver is bright but not gold-toned. Some customers in my Etsy shop specifically asked for gold engraving on black. For those orders, I use anodized gold blanks instead.

Best use cases and compatibility
These blanks excel for networking cards, gift cards, and QR-code displays. CO2 lasers at 30W or higher produce the best results. Fiber lasers handle them well too. Diode lasers work with air assist and slower speeds.
Engrave at 400 dpi for crisp logos and 600 dpi for fine text. Below 300 dpi looks pixelated on the glossy surface.
Who should skip these blanks
If you need thick, rigid cards that feel like premium steel, look at the Tandefio stainless steel option below. Skip these if your customers want gold-tone engraving on dark backgrounds.

Tandefio’s stainless steel blanks deliver a genuinely premium feel. When I handed one to a friend, she assumed it was a credit card before noticing the engraving. This is the blank to reach for when your customer wants real weight and a luxurious impression.
The 304 stainless steel engraves beautifully with fiber lasers. I used a 30W fiber unit at 80 percent power and 200 mm/s, and the result was a crisp dark gray etch that contrasts well against the silver surface. CO2 lasers cannot mark bare stainless steel effectively, so this blank really requires fiber equipment.

The protective film on both sides prevents scratches during shipping. Removing it requires a fingernail or plastic scraper. I had to be careful not to bend the thin 0.2mm variant during peeling. The thicker 0.8mm option feels much more substantial.
The 0.2mm thickness I tested bends easily under thumb pressure. For business cards, this is acceptable because they live in wallets. For tags or any application where bending is likely, spring for the 0.8mm variant.
Diode lasers struggle here because the blue wavelength reflects off stainless steel. Even with high power, you will not get a mark. CO2 lasers are similarly ineffective. This blank is fiber-only territory.

Best use cases and compatibility
Best for luxury business cards, executive gifts, and high-end product tags. Fiber laser is required for marking. Choose 0.8mm thickness for rigidity, 0.4mm for balance, or 0.2mm for cost savings.
Pre-test your power settings on a single blank before a full batch. Stainless steel is unforgiving, and overshooting power can create rough edges.
Who should skip these blanks
If you only have a diode or CO2 laser, this is not the blank for you. Also skip if your customers expect vivid color contrast, since stainless steel gives you gray-on-gray at best.

ALRALLI’s challenge coin blanks opened up a new product line for me. Military unit coins, corporate recognition awards, and wedding favor medallions all sold well after I added these to my catalog. Each coin ships in its own acrylic protection case, which adds immediate presentation value.
The silver plating looks bright out of the box. I tested these on my 30W fiber laser, and the mark came out as a darker gray against the silver surface. Contrast is decent but not as dramatic as coated aluminum blanks.

The construction is silver plating over copper plating over a zinc alloy core. When you engrave deeply enough to reach the copper layer, the color shifts to a reddish-orange. This actually works well for two-tone designs but surprises customers who expect pure silver.
The threaded edge detail adds a real coin feel. Buyers often comment that these feel like government-issued challenge coins rather than blanks. I priced mine at 18 dollars per coin and had consistent sell-through.
Fine detail is where these coins struggle. Anything below 1mm line thickness tends to bleed or fill in during engraving. For logos and large text, they work great. For tiny serial numbers or fine portraits, look elsewhere.

Best use cases and compatibility
Fiber lasers work best on these alloy blanks. CO2 lasers cannot mark the metal directly. Diode lasers struggle because the silver plating reflects the blue wavelength.
Stick to bold designs, large text, and simple icons. Engrave at moderate depth to avoid the copper layer unless you specifically want the two-tone effect.
Who should skip these blanks
If your designs rely on tiny text or photographic detail, these coins will not deliver. Also skip if you need pure silver-tone engraving without copper undertones.

Aweyka’s unfinished pine coasters fill a gap between thin plywood sheets and thick hardwood blanks. At 0.35 inch thickness, these rounds feel substantial in the hand. I tested them as both coasters and Christmas ornaments, and both applications worked beautifully.
The pine wood engraves with a medium-dark burn that takes stain exceptionally well. I finished mine with a light Danish oil, and the contrast between engraved and non-engraved areas really popped. The 4 inch round fits standard drinkware and Christmas ornament hooks.

The 170 included anti-slip felt dots are a nice bonus. Stick them on the bottom and the coasters stay put on glass tables. This small touch adds professional polish to the finished product.
Pine grain varies more than plywood or MDF. Some pieces have tight grain that engraves cleanly. Others have wider grain with more resin pockets that can char. I sorted my blanks by grain tightness before each batch run.
When sealed with clear coat, the wood darkens significantly. This is actually attractive but surprised a few customers who expected the raw color. I now include a note about the natural color shift with each order.

Best use cases and compatibility
Great for craft fair coasters, Christmas ornaments, and rustic wedding decor. Both diode and CO2 lasers handle pine well. Use lower power on diode lasers to avoid excessive charring.
Sand lightly with 220-grit before engraving for the smoothest results. Apply stain after engraving rather than before to maintain clean lines.
Who should skip these blanks
If you need perfectly uniform grain across every piece, hardwoods like maple or walnut are better choices. Pine is a budget-friendly option with natural variation.

Mezchi’s colored acrylic sheets became my standard for custom signage, cake toppers, and decorative ornaments. The cast acrylic engraves far cleaner than extruded acrylic. You get crisp white lines against vibrant color, which produces eye-catching results every time.
The 10-pack comes in 10 different colors, which is perfect for sample displays and variety orders. I keep a small rack of these sheets next to my laser for impulse custom orders. Each 8 by 8 inch sheet yields roughly 4 standard-size ornaments or signs.

Protective film on both sides prevents scratches during shipping. I peel only the top film before engraving and leave the bottom in place to protect the laser bed. After cutting, I peel both films for a polished finish.
Diode lasers struggle with some colors, especially green. The blue wavelength bounces off certain pigments. CO2 lasers handle all colors cleanly. If you only have a diode, stick to red, blue, and white acrylics.
Color accuracy online is hit or miss. The red is more orange than the image suggests. The blue is slightly darker. Always order one sheet first to verify the color matches your brand before committing to bulk.

Best use cases and compatibility
Best for cake toppers, wedding signs, ornaments, and decorative wall art. CO2 lasers at 40W or higher produce the cleanest cuts. Diode lasers work on select colors with reduced power.
Ventilation is critical when cutting acrylic. The fumes are unpleasant and potentially harmful. Always run your exhaust fan and consider a dedicated acrylic cutting filter.
Who should skip these blanks
If you only have a diode laser and want green or yellow acrylic, look for diode-specific options. Also skip if you need precise color matching without ordering samples first.

Buying Guide: How to Choose the Best Blanks for Laser Engraving
Choosing the best blanks for laser engraving depends on five factors: laser type, material compatibility, thickness, surface prep, and target margin. Get any one wrong, and you waste time and money on pieces that do not sell or do not engrave well.
Material vs Laser Type Compatibility
Diode lasers work best on wood, leather, paper, dark acrylics, and coated metals. They struggle with bare metals, glass, and light-colored acrylics. CO2 lasers are the most versatile, handling wood, acrylic, leather, glass with coating, coated metals, slate, and many plastics. Fiber lasers are required for bare stainless steel, titanium, anodized aluminum, and most alloys. Check your laser manual before buying blanks in bulk.
Sizing, Thickness, and Finish Considerations
Thickness affects both durability and laser compatibility. Thin sheets under 1mm warp easily under diode lasers. Thick hardwoods over 6mm require multiple passes or higher power. Surface finish matters too: glossy surfaces show fingerprints but produce crisp engravings. Matte surfaces hide fingerprints but may need paint infill for contrast.
Pre-Made Blanks vs Raw Sheets
Pre-made blanks like coasters, keychains, and business cards save cutting time and arrive ready to engrave. Raw sheets cost less per square inch but require cutting and finishing. For low-volume custom orders, pre-made blanks win on time savings. For high-volume production, raw sheets win on per-piece cost.
Most Profitable Blanks and Margins
The highest-margin blanks in my shop are slate coasters (selling for 18 to 28 dollars per piece), stainless steel business cards (selling for 4 to 7 dollars per card), and custom keychains (selling for 8 to 15 dollars per piece). The lowest-margin blanks are raw wood sheets and basic acrylic, which compete directly with big-box craft stores on price.
Common Mistakes to Avoid
The biggest mistake I see new laser operators make is skipping test pieces. Always run 3 to 5 blanks at different power settings before committing to a full batch. The second biggest mistake is forgetting air assist on diode lasers when working with thin metal. Without air assist, heat builds up and warps the blank. The third mistake is using wrong film or no film on acrylic, which leaves residue burns on the surface.
Frequently Asked Questions About Laser Engraving Blanks
What are laser engraving blanks?
Laser engraving blanks are unfinished, ready-to-engrave products or raw materials such as wood, acrylic, metal, leather, or glass designed specifically for laser customization. They provide a compatible surface where a laser beam can precisely burn or vaporize material to create designs, text, or patterns with high contrast and detail.
Which materials are best suited for laser engraving blanks?
The best materials depend on your laser type. Diode lasers excel on wood, leather, paper, dark acrylics, and coated metals. CO2 lasers handle wood, acrylic, leather, glass with coating, coated metals, slate, and most plastics. Fiber lasers are required for bare stainless steel, anodized aluminum, titanium, and alloys. Slate and anodized aluminum produce the highest contrast results.
Can I laser engrave on PU leather blanks?
Yes, PU leather blanks laser engrave cleanly on both diode and CO2 lasers. Use moderate power and strong air assist to prevent the synthetic material from melting or producing excessive fumes. PU leather produces a dark burn that contrasts well against the original surface color. Always ventilate your workspace when engraving synthetic materials.
How do I prepare laser engraving blanks for best results?
Start by cleaning the blank surface with isopropyl alcohol to remove oils and dust. Remove any protective film right before engraving, not days earlier. Set your Z-axis height precisely for the material thickness. Run 3 to 5 test pieces at different power and speed settings to dial in your parameters before committing to a full batch.
